Add 9/14 and 90/56
1st number: 9/14, 2nd number: 1 34/56
9/14 + 90/56 is 9/4.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 14 and 56 is 56
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 56 - For the 1st fraction, since 14 × 4 = 56,
9/14 = 9 × 4/14 × 4 = 36/56 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 56 × 1 = 56,
90/56 = 90 × 1/56 × 1 = 90/56 - Add the two like fractions:
36/56 + 90/56 = 36 + 90/56 = 126/56 - 126/56 simplified gives 9/4
- So, 9/14 + 90/56 = 9/4
